The LM6172IN/NOPB is a high-performance, dual high-speed operational amplifier from Texas Instruments. This device is designed to offer a perfect balance of speed, power, and performance, making it an ideal choice for a wide range of applications, including video and audio processing, telecommunications, and test equipment.

Key Features:

  • High Speed: With a 100 MHz unity-gain bandwidth and a 3000 V/μs slew rate, the LM6172IN/NOPB is capable of handling fast signal transitions, ensuring minimal distortion in high-speed signal processing.
  • Low Distortion: Total harmonic distortion plus noise (THD+N) is remarkably low, which makes this operational amplifier suitable for high-fidelity audio applications and other precision analog tasks.
  • Low Power Consumption: Despite its high-speed capabilities, the LM6172IN/NOPB maintains a low power consumption, making it suitable for battery-operated and portable devices without compromising performance.
  • Voltage Range: The device operates from a single supply voltage range of +2.7V to +12V or a dual supply of ±2.7V to ±6V, providing flexibility in various circuit configurations.
  • Output Current: It can deliver a continuous output current of 100 mA, which is ample for driving a variety of loads.
